The final day of testing, at Bahrain on Saturday, did nothing to change the impression given in the preceding two days that Red Bull look set to begin 2023 just as strongly as they finished 2022.
Ferrari and Aston Martin looked very evenly matched for pace as the next fastest after Red Bull, with Mercedes trailing just behind them by Saturday.
